1-(Fluoromethyl)-3-nitrobenzene

Description:
1-(Fluoromethyl)-3-nitrobenzene, with the CAS number 455-94-7, is an organic compound characterized by the presence of a nitro group (-NO2) and a fluoromethyl group (-CH2F) attached to a benzene ring. This compound typically appears as a pale yellow to light brown liquid or solid, depending on its physical state at room temperature. It is known for its aromatic properties, which contribute to its stability and reactivity. The presence of both the nitro and fluoromethyl groups introduces significant polarity, influencing its solubility in various solvents and its reactivity in chemical reactions. This compound is often utilized in organic synthesis and may serve as an intermediate in the production of pharmaceuticals or agrochemicals. Safety considerations are important when handling this substance, as it may pose health risks through inhalation or skin contact. Proper storage and handling protocols should be followed to mitigate any potential hazards associated with its use.
Formula:C7H6FNO2
InChI:InChI=1S/C7H6FNO2/c8-5-6-2-1-3-7(4-6)9(10)11/h1-4H,5H2
InChI key:InChIKey=LMBGIKKCVSXJER-UHFFFAOYSA-N
SMILES:N(=O)(=O)C1=CC(CF)=CC=C1
Synonyms:
  • α-Fluoro-3-nitrotoluene
  • 3-Nitrobenzyl fluoride
  • 1-(Fluoromethyl)-3-nitrobenzene
  • Benzene, 1-(fluoromethyl)-3-nitro-
  • Toluene, α-fluoro-m-nitro-
